Apply to this job to kick off the process. \n\n\n* \nJOB TYPE: Freelance, Contract Position (no agencies/C2C - see notes below)\n\n* \nLOCATION: Remote - United States only (TimeZone: PST/CIST | Partial overlap)\n\n* \nHOURLY RANGE: Our client is looking to pay $90 โ $110/hr\n\n* \nESTIMATED DURATION: 40h/week - Long term\n\n\n\n\nTHE OPPORTUNITY\nRequirements\n\nRequired:\n\n\n* \n\nProfessional Experience building iOS apps (5+ years)\n\n\n* \n\nExperience working with mobile automation frameworks (Appium, Webdriver) and iOS app profiling tools.\n\n\n* \n\nProficient in at least one iOS coding language (Swift, ObjectiveC)\n\n\n\n\n\n\n* \n\nExcellent code quality, testability, and knowledge of good engineering practices.\n\n\n* \n\nGoogle experience HIGHLY preferred.\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\nPluses:\n\n \n\n\n* \n\nExperience in early stage projects \n\n\n* \n\nExperience building data privacy products\n\n\n\n\n\n \n\nWhat youโll be working on\n\n\n\nOur client is seeking an iOS developer that has experience building native iOS apps (Swift, Objective C), and that has a deep understanding of the iOS ecosystem. Our team is helping app developers build privacy-compliant products. We built an AI/ML based platform that uses app signals and artificial intelligence to assess how an app behavior compares with app policies and regulations. \n\n \n\nThe teamโs mission is โTo create a safer digital ecosystem by simplifying privacy and reducing risk for app developersโ. We are a lively, entrepreneurial and fun team working on making the world a better place, one app scan at a time.\n\n \n\nThe role is for building technology that will help us better understand iOS apps and the ecosystem, integrate with developer workflows, and provide rich assessment of app metadata. \n\n \n\nScope:\n\n\n* \n\nBuild iOS instrumentation using XCode or related iOS technologies\n\n\n* \n\nBuild APIs, CLI and libraries for app analysis\n\n\n* \n\nRapidly build out features and refactor code/components\n\n\n* \n\nEnable quick build-measure-learn cycles\n\n\n* \n\nDemonstrate flexibility, persistence, & resourcefulness \n\n\n* \n\nShow a deep, unabiding appreciation for 80/20 thinking/execution\n\n\n* \n\nWork cross-functionally with other engineers, product, UX & other business partners.\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\nApply Now!\n\nBraintrust Job ID: 6574\n\n \n\nC2C Candidates: This role is not available to C2C candidates working with an agency.
